These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Water Well Driller in the United States. The base salary for Water Well Driller ranges from $51,747 to $74,314 with the average base salary of $60,351. Salaries in oil drilling industry Roustabout Salary Roustabouts, are general laborers doing every kind of manual labor on oil rigs like lifting, carrying, moving around different mechanisms, cleaning and painting everything that needs to be painted on an offshore oil rig.

These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Drilling Operations Supervisor in the United States. The base salary for Drilling Operations Supervisor ranges from $96,919 to $128,499 with the average base salary of $110,503. The national average salary for a Driller is $89,916 in United States.
